What Are Ground Squirrels?

Ground squirrels are a species of rodents that do not live in trees, but rather underground, as their name suggests. Although often mistaken for chipmunks, ground squirrels are actually tiny prairie dogs. These marsupial rodents are equipped with cheek pouches that they use to carry fruits, seeds, and other gathered foods. Ground squirrels can commonly be found in open grassland and grain fields where they live beneath the ground in burrows. Despite their size, the holes ground squirrels dig can be quite large, not because they enjoy higher ceilings and more space for decorating, but because ground squirrels live in families with up to 10 per burrow. In these burrows, ground squirrels live, store food, and feed their young. The holes created by these squirrels can be large enough to trip a full-grown human and can cause many other problems for homeowners.

Problems Ground Squirrels Cause

If you value your health and the health of your yard, ground squirrels are the last creatures you want running and digging freely about. Just like their cousins, rats and mice, ground squirrels can be hosts for a range of serious diseases including the plague. Ground squirrels can also pose a risk with the pests they carry. Both fleas and ticks go hand in hand with these furry creatures. When brought close to homes, these parasitic pests can leap off them and onto your household pets. These parasite pests bring their own slew of problems.

Ground squirrels are extremely difficult to prevent. Their holes allow them to stay out of sight and avoid any treatments you may try to use against them. It is not uncommon for them to dig large holes under concrete, patios, and fences. This in and of itself can lead to damage to your property.
